This optical device combines a compact, tubular design with a projected red dot aiming point, specifically a 4 Minute of Angle (MOA) dot. This means the dot covers approximately 4 inches at 100 yards, providing a balance between precise aiming and target acquisition speed. Such devices are frequently mounted on firearms, particularly rifles and shotguns, to enhance aiming capabilities.

Compact red dot sights offer several advantages for shooters. Their small size and light weight minimize impact on weapon balance and handling. The single red dot provides an uncluttered sight picture, allowing for rapid target acquisition, especially in dynamic shooting scenarios or low-light conditions. The 4 MOA dot size strikes a useful compromise: small enough for reasonable precision at moderate ranges, yet large enough for quick target acquisition. This technology has evolved significantly over the years, offering increased durability, battery life, and a wider range of adjustments compared to earlier generations.

3. Red dot sight type

Categorizing the Tasco ProPoint as a “red dot sight” defines its core functionality and operating principles. Red dot sights utilize an internal LED or other light source to project a small, illuminated dot onto a lens. This projected dot serves as the aiming point, superimposed on the target’s image. This differs fundamentally from traditional iron sights or magnified scopes. The non-magnifying nature of red dot sights prioritizes speed and intuitive aiming, making them highly effective in close- to medium-range engagements. This characteristic directly influences the ProPoint’s suitability for applications requiring rapid target acquisition, such as competitive shooting or hunting fast-moving game. For example, in a fast-paced shooting competition, the uncluttered sight picture offered by a red dot allows for quicker transitions between targets compared to using iron sights or a scope.

The “red dot sight” classification also implies certain design considerations relevant to the ProPoint. These sights typically feature compact and lightweight construction, minimizing their impact on weapon handling and maneuverability. Furthermore, red dot sights generally offer adjustable brightness settings to adapt to various lighting conditions. This adaptability proves crucial in transitioning between bright sunlight and shaded areas, ensuring the red dot remains clearly visible without overwhelming the target. The ProPoint likely incorporates these features, reflecting standard design principles within the red dot sight category. For instance, the ProPoint’s compact size and relatively low weight make it a suitable option for mounting on pistols or carbines where maintaining a balanced and agile platform is essential.

4. 4 MOA reticle size

The 4 Minute of Angle (MOA) reticle size is a defining characteristic of the Tasco ProPoint red dot sight. This specification directly impacts sight picture, target acquisition speed, and practical accuracy. 4 MOA signifies that the projected red dot covers approximately 4 inches at a distance of 100 yards. This size represents a balance between precision and speed. A smaller dot offers greater precision for pinpoint aiming, but can be harder to acquire quickly, especially in dynamic scenarios or low-light conditions. Conversely, a larger dot facilitates rapid target acquisition, but can obscure smaller targets at longer ranges. The 4 MOA dot size in the Tasco ProPoint aims to provide a versatile solution suitable for a range of applications. For example, in close-quarters shooting or hunting moving targets, the 4 MOA dot allows for rapid sight alignment, increasing the likelihood of a successful shot. However, this reticle size may prove less ideal for precision long-range shooting where a smaller dot would offer finer aiming capabilities.

Practical implications of the 4 MOA dot size become evident when considering specific shooting scenarios. In competitive pistol shooting, where targets are typically engaged at relatively close ranges, the 4 MOA dot facilitates quick transitions between targets without sacrificing necessary accuracy. In hunting applications, particularly for larger game animals, the 4 MOA dot provides sufficient precision while ensuring rapid target acquisition, even in challenging terrain or low-light conditions. Consider a hunter engaging a deer at 50 yards; the 4 MOA dot would cover approximately 2 inches, offering ample accuracy for an ethical shot placement. However, at 200 yards, the same dot would cover 8 inches, potentially obscuring vital areas on smaller targets. This emphasizes the importance of understanding the reticle size’s limitations relative to target size and distance.

Question 1: Is the Tasco ProPoint suitable for long-range shooting?

While functional at moderate ranges, the ProPoint’s design prioritizes close- to medium-range engagements. The 4 MOA dot can cover significant target area at longer distances, potentially hindering precise shot placement. Magnified optics are generally preferred for long-range applications.

Question 2: How does the 4 MOA dot size impact aiming precision?

The 4 MOA dot covers approximately 4 inches at 100 yards. While suitable for rapid target acquisition, this size might limit precision when engaging smaller targets at extended ranges. Smaller dot sizes offer greater precision but can be more challenging to acquire quickly.

Tips for Effective Use

Maximizing the effectiveness of a red dot sight requires attention to several key factors. These tips offer practical guidance for utilizing optics like the Tasco ProPoint with a 4 MOA dot reticle.

Tip 1: Zeroing for Optimal Accuracy

Proper zeroing is paramount for accurate shot placement. Zeroing involves adjusting the sight’s point of impact to coincide with the point of aim at a specific distance. Following the manufacturer’s instructions and utilizing a stable shooting rest enhances zeroing precision.

Tip 2: Brightness Adjustment for Varying Conditions

Adjusting the reticle’s brightness to match ambient lighting is crucial for optimal visibility. Excessive brightness can lead to washout, while insufficient brightness hinders rapid target acquisition. Experimenting with different brightness settings in varying lighting conditions allows users to find the optimal setting for each scenario.

Tip 3: Proper Mounting and Secure Attachment

Ensuring secure mounting to the firearm is essential for maintaining zero and preventing sight movement during recoil. Using appropriate mounts and following the manufacturer’s installation instructions minimizes the risk of shifting or loosening.

Tip 4: Understanding Eye Relief and Reticle Focus

Red dot sights offer generous eye relief, meaning precise eye placement is less critical. However, understanding the optimal viewing distance and ensuring a crisp reticle focus contributes to comfortable and efficient aiming.

Tip 5: Battery Management and Replacement

Regularly checking battery status and carrying spare batteries prevents disruptions during critical moments. Understanding the sight’s power-saving features and utilizing appropriate battery types maximizes operational lifespan.

Tip 6: Practice and Training for Proficiency

Proficiency with any sighting system requires dedicated practice. Regular dry-fire exercises and live-fire training enhance familiarity with the sight’s characteristics and improve target acquisition speed and accuracy. This includes practicing target transitions and engaging moving targets.

Tip 7: Cleaning and Maintenance for Longevity

Proper care and maintenance ensure the optic’s long-term functionality. Regularly cleaning the lenses with appropriate lens cloths and protecting the sight from harsh environmental conditions extends its lifespan and maintains optimal performance.
